# Event Study: Cumulative Abnormal Returns (CARs)
A complete methodology reference for computing publication-quality CARs with robust test statistics, matching the rigor of Kaspereit's eventstudy2 (v3.2b) for Stata. This skill is **generic** — applicable to any market, asset class, or event type.

## Methodology Overview: The 8-Step Pipeline
### Step 1: Build Trading Calendar (Dateline)
Construct a master list of valid trading dates from the security returns file.
1. Collect all unique dates on which at least one security has a non-missing return (or, if using a factor model, dates where market/factor returns exist). 2. Count the number of securities with valid returns on each date. 3. Optionally drop weekends (`delweekend`). 4. Apply `dateline_threshold`: drop dates where the count of return observations falls below `threshold × mean(daily_count)`. A threshold of 0.2 works well for international samples with heterogeneous holidays. 5. The resulting date vector is the **dateline** — all downstream windows are defined in dateline time (relative trading days), not calendar time.
### Step 2: Map Event Dates to Nearest Valid Trading Day
For each event: 1. Find the nearest dateline date **on or after** the event date. 2. If the shift exceeds `max_shift` calendar days (default: 3), **exclude** the event entirely — do not silently map it to a distant trading day. 3. Events with missing dates, or dates outside the dateline range, are also excluded and logged with the reason.
### Step 3: Construct Estimation and Event Windows
For each firm-event pair, define windows in **relative trading time** (offsets from the event day on the dateline):
- **Estimation window**: `[esw_lb, esw_ub]` — default `[-250, -30]`. - **Event window**: `[evw_lb, evw_ub]` — determined by the widest CAR window requested. - Enforce a **gap** between the estimation and event windows to prevent event contamination of the benchmark model.
**Exclusion checks** (per firm-event): - Insufficient estimation-window observations (fewer than `min_esw_obs`, default 120). - Insufficient event-window observations. - **IPO/delisting guard**: if the stock's first observed return date falls after `evw_lb` or last observed return date falls before `evw_ub`, exclude the firm-event. These are survivorship-biased observations.
### Step 4: Apply Thin-Trading Adjustment
For markets with non-trivially thin trading (most markets outside US mega-caps), apply the Maynes-Rumsey (1993) trade-to-trade transformation **by default**.
> Read `references/thin_trading.md` for the complete transformation, including > the `cum_periods` construction, the regression specification with `nocons`, > and the boundary contamination guard.
**Summary**: Non-trading days accumulate into the next trading day's return. All variables (returns, factors, intercept) are divided by `sqrt(cum_periods)`. OLS is run with `nocons` because the intercept regressor `1/sqrt(d)` replaces the standard constant. This is a GLS correction for the heteroscedasticity introduced by multi-period returns.
### Step 5: Run OLS and Compute STDF
For each firm-event pair, estimate the benchmark model over the estimation window and compute the **standard deviation of forecast** (STDF) for every observation (estimation + event window).
> Read `references/estimation_models.md` for model specifications (RAW, > COMEAN, MA, FM, BHAR).
**STDF** (Theil 1971 prediction error correction):
For each observation t, the forecast standard deviation is:
STDF_it = sigma_hat_i * sqrt(1 + x'_t (X'X)^{-1} x_t)
where `x_t` is the regressor vector at time t, `X` is the estimation-window design matrix, and `sigma_hat_i = sqrt(SSR / (T_i - 2 - df))` is the OLS residual standard deviation. `df` is the number of additional factors beyond the market (0 for market model, 2 for FF3, etc.).
The STDF accounts for both the inherent noise in returns (sigma) and the estimation uncertainty in the model coefficients (which grows when event-window factor values are far from estimation-window means).
**Python**: after `numpy.linalg.lstsq`, compute the hat matrix `H = X @ inv(X'X) @ X'` and `h_t = x'_t @ inv(X'X) @ x_t` for each event-window observation. Then `STDF_t = sigma_hat * sqrt(1 + h_t)`.
### Step 6: Compute Abnormal Returns
AR_it = R_it - predicted_it
where `predicted_it` comes from the estimated benchmark model applied to event-window factor values.
**Critical rule**: do NOT zero-fill missing event-window returns. A missing return means the stock did not trade — setting it to zero biases CARs toward zero for illiquid stocks. Leave it as NaN and let the accumulation step handle the count of valid ARs.
### Step 7: Accumulate CARs
For each requested CAR window `[lb, ub]` and each firm-event:
CAR_i = sum of AR_it for t in [lb, ub] where AR_it is not NaN
**Boundary contamination guard** (from eventstudy2): - If the **first** day of the CAR window has `cum_periods > 1`, the return on that day spans back before the window start. Set CAR = NaN. - If the **last** day of the CAR window has a missing AR, the firm-event lacks coverage at the window boundary. Set CAR = NaN. - For AAR (day-by-day) output: any day with `cum_periods > 1` has its AR set to NaN (the multi-period return cannot be attributed to a single day).
Track `n_valid_ar` per CAR: the count of non-NaN ARs in the window. A valid CAR should have `n_valid_ar == window_length`. CARs with fewer valid days should be flagged or excluded depending on the analysis.
### Step 8: Compute Test Statistics
Compute at minimum: **Patell (1976)**, **BMP (Boehmer et al. 1991)**, **Kolari-Pynnonen adjusted BMP**, and the **generalized sign test (Cowan 1992)**. For maximum rigor, compute all 13 tests.
> Read `references/test_statistics.md` for exact formulas, null hypotheses, > distributions, and Python implementation notes for all 13 tests.
> Read `references/kolari_pynnonen.md` for the cross-correlation adjustment > procedure (ADJ factor) and the GRANK-T test.
Test statistics are reported at two levels: - **AAR level**: one test statistic per event day (tests whether the average AR across firms is significantly different from zero on that day). - **CAAR level**: one test statistic per CAR window (tests whether the cumulative average AR is significantly different from zero over the window).

## Model Selection
> Read `references/estimation_models.md` for full mathematical specifications.
| Model | When to Use | |-------|-------------| | **RAW** | Baseline/diagnostic only. No benchmark subtracted. | | **COMEAN** | Simplest parametric benchmark (constant mean return). | | **MA** (market-adjusted) | When factor data is unavailable. Subtracts market return directly. | | **FM** (factor model) | Standard choice for short-window event studies. Market model (1 factor) or FF3/FF5/Carhart (multi-factor). | | **BHAR** | Long-horizon event studies (months/years). Requires skewness-adjusted bootstrap (Lyon et al. 1999). |
Default: **FM with market model** (1 factor) for short-window studies.
---
## Critical Rules
1. **NEVER** replace missing event-window returns with zero. This biases CARs toward zero for illiquid stocks. The only exception is BHAR models, which assume continuous holding.
2. **NEVER** compute CARs when the stock's first/last trading date falls inside the event window (IPO/delisting bias).
3. **NEVER** sum CARs when a boundary day has `cum_periods > 1` — the return spans outside the intended window.
4. **NEVER** run OLS with a standard constant when using the trade-to-trade transformation. Use `nocons` with `1/sqrt(cum_periods)` as the intercept regressor.
5. **NEVER** report CARs without at least one parametric and one non-parametric test statistic.
6. **NEVER** mix log and simple returns between the LHS and RHS of the market model. If stock returns are in logs, factor returns must also be in logs (or convert both via `ln(1+R)` before estimation). Jensen's inequality creates bias otherwise.

## Sensible Defaults
These can be overridden by the user:
| Parameter | Default | Notes | |-----------|---------|-------| | Estimation window | `[-250, -30]` | ~1 year of trading days | | Min estimation obs | 120 | Conservative; eventstudy2 defaults to 30 | | Event window | Widest CAR window | Determined by user's CAR windows | | Max event-date shift | 3 calendar days | Beyond this, exclude the event | | Dateline threshold | 0.0 | Include all trading days (set ~0.2 for international samples) | | Thin-trading adjustment | ON | Disable only for extremely liquid markets | | Log returns | Convert via `ln(1+R)` | Unless input is already in logs | | Min event-window obs | 1 | Per eventstudy2 default | | Kolari-Pynnonen ADJ | Computed | Skip only if N > 500 firms (O(N^2) cost) |
